DAN White took 4-26 as Hook Norton got off to a flying start in Division 2 of the Banbury Indoor League.
White’s superb haul set up a five-wicket victory over Great & Little Tew in the opening round of the competition.
Tew were shot out for 78 in nine overs, with Dickie Knight then hitting an unbeaten 28 as Hook Norton took just 6.5 overs to pass their target.
Barry Nutt hit a rare indoor cricket half-century, but his 54 could not save Charlbury A from a 14-run defeat against Sandford A.
